A resting stand used to hold the neck of a guitar (electric, acoustic, bass, etc.) so you can perform maintenance like replacing string, removing pickups, etc. without making the guitar wobbles around and bumps its headstock due to uneven weight distribution or its overall shape. Can be used for ukulele, violin, and other string instruments as well, though it was designed for standard 6-string guitar neck in mind. See the image for recommended printing orientation. Parts: FDM prints the Body with hard plastics like PLA, ABS, PETG, etc. FDM prints the Pad with flexible material like TPU, TPE, etc. You could print this with hard plastics but you might risk scratching the guitar neck. Assembly: Just put an adhesive in between the parts.
